Listen "409 Expanding Your Comfort Zone"
Episode Synopsis
409 Expanding Your Comfort Zone In today's episode Sarah Elkins ruminates on how she has expanded her comfort zone by stepping into what she calls the "stretch zone", where you aren't entirely comfortable yet but willing to try just so that you can see what you're made of. If we never stretch our wings, we'll be trapped in the nest forever, so have faith in yourself, step into your stretch zone, and see how far it can take you. Highlights Telling stories to connect with another, not to change their mind. Taking time to calibrate yourself and find inner peace. Turning your stretch zone into your comfort zone, one step at a time. Quotes "The stories we share influence how we're perceived, and even when a listener isn't consciously aware they're picking up signals about who we are and whether we can be trusted." "To be comfortable with discomfort we have to embrace and define what our comfort zone looks like, and how it feels." About Sarah "Uncovering the right stories for the right audiences so executives, leaders, public speakers, and job seekers can clearly and actively demonstrate their character, values, and vision." In my work with coaching clients, I guide people to improve their communication using storytelling as the foundation of our work together. What I've realized over years of coaching and podcasting is that the majority of people don't realize the impact of the stories they share - on their internal messages, and on the people they're sharing them with. My work with leaders and people who aspire to be leaders follows a similar path to the interviews on my podcast, uncovering pivotal moments in their lives and learning how to share them to connect more authentically with others, to make their presentations and speaking more engaging, to reveal patterns that have kept them stuck or moved them forward, and to improve their relationships at work and at home.
